Looks pretty good although obviously I've not checked it out fully. Interestingly there was some kind of error showing on the Aerosoft downloads when I tried to download the 318/319 (which I also bought and figured I'd reinstall since it might have been updated), but the 320 and 321 downloaded no problem.

Bit bizarre that they included a Monarch 321 since that Airline went bump last year, but nothing wrong with having the odd historic livery I guess. I actually work on some of those ex-Monarch 321s, which Thomas Cook have in temporary hybrid liveries, and they're a pain in the @ss to load because the cargo hold floors are really awkward since they are plated over for loose baggage, so my virtual sympathies go out to those GSX rampies, I feel their pain lol.

Works with GSX2 but note this is something GSX2 gets not quite correct. Neither Swissport nor Menzies (the only two choices you get in GSX2) are the service agents for these aeroplanes, we service them (Aviator), and they don't have palletted baggage either, so those hi-lows should really be baggage belts, but I still think GSX is great anyway and it clearly works with this A321 okay.
